Sediq Afghan

Sediq Afghan is a prominent Afghan philosopher known for his outspoken criticism of the Soviet invasion of Afghanistan, of the secular governments that followed, and of the Taliban regime.

In Kabul, he led anti-U.S. protests during May of 2003.
